MongoDB是一种流行的开源文档数据库,被广泛用于各种应用程序和项目中。然而,有时候在使用MongoDB时,您可能会遇到错误代码 - 45 - 用户数据不一致的问题。本文将介绍这个错误的原因以及如何修复它。
错误代码 - 45 - 用户数据不一致通常是由于MongoDB中的数据冲突或不一致引起的。这可能是由于以下原因之一:
修复错误代码 - 45 - 用户数据不一致的方法取决于具体的情况和原因。以下是一些常见的修复方法:
MongoDB提供了一些内置工具来修复数据不一致的问题。其中一个工具是`db.repairDatabase()`方法,它可以修复数据库中的损坏数据。您可以通过以下步骤使用该方法:
db.repairDatabase()
请注意,修复数据库可能需要一些时间,具体时间取决于数据库的大小和复杂性。
如果您的MongoDB部署使用了副本集,您可以使用副本集来恢复数据。副本集是MongoDB的一种高可用性解决方案,它可以在主节点发生故障时自动切换到备用节点。
要使用副本集进行数据恢复,请按照以下步骤操作:
rs.status()
rs.stepDown()
如果您有备份数据,您可以使用备份数据来恢复数据库。这是一种常见的数据恢复方法,但需要确保备份数据是最新的。
要恢复备份数据,请按照以下步骤操作:
请注意,在使用备份数据恢复数据库之前,请确保您已经备份了最新的数据,并且没有其他客户端正在写入数据。
修复MongoDB错误代码 - 45 - 用户数据不一致可能需要根据具体情况采取不同的方法。您可以尝试使用MongoDB的内置工具修复数据,使用副本集进行数据恢复,或者恢复备份数据。根据您的具体情况选择合适的方法。
如果您正在寻找可靠的香港服务器提供商,创新互联是您的选择。我们提供高性能的香港服务器,以及其他多种服务器和云计算解决方案。
文章名称:如何修复MongoDB错误代码-45-用户数据不一致
文章位置:http://www.csdahua.cn/qtweb/news36/321136.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网